Tools and Supplies Needed

  • Phillips screwdriver
  • Wire stripper
  • Hammer
  • Valve wire: direct burial, color coded multi-strand (not included)
  • 18 gauge for runs less than 800 feet.
  • 14 gauge for runs greater than 800 feet.
  • Watertight splice connectors (not included)

Installation

Mount Timer
  • For indoor installation, choose a location within 5 feet of an AC power outlet and at least 15 feet away from major appliances or air conditioners.
  • Drive a screw into the wall, leaving an 1/8″ gap between the screw-head and the wall (use the supplied wall anchors if necessary).
  • Locate the keyhole slot on back of the unit and hang it securely on the screw.
  • Remove the wiring bay cover at the bottom of the unit and drive a screw through the center hole as shown (use the supplied wall anchors if necessary).Rain Bird SST600in 6-Station Indoor Simple-To-Set Irrigation Timer - 1

Connect Valve Wires To Timer

Valve Connections

  • Use direct burial cable to run wiring from the timer to valves in the field.
  • Connect a color coded wire from the direct burial cable to either wire on the valve.
  • Connect the remaining wire on each valve to a “common” wire which then connects to the timer

Timer Connections

  • Use a wire stripper to strip away approximately 1/4″ of insulation from the end of the valve wire.
  • Push the exposed end of the color coded wire from each external valve (or zone) into the corresponding zone number on the terminal block.
  • Connect the common wire to one of the COMMON slots on the terminal block.Rain Bird SST600in 6-Station Indoor Simple-To-Set Irrigation Timer - 6
  • Check that all wiring connections are secureRain Bird SST600in 6-Station Indoor Simple-To-Set Irrigation Timer - 7

Master Valve Or Pump Start Relay

Connect an optional master valve or pump start relay

  • SST timers support the use of a master valve or pump start relay. A pump start relay connects to the timer the same way as a master valve, but connects differently at the water source.
  • Using a direct burial cable, connect one of the wires from the master valve (or pump start relay) to the timer terminal marked MSTR VALVE.Rain Bird SST600in 6-Station Indoor Simple-To-Set Irrigation Timer - 11
  • Using a direct burial cable, connect the remaining wire from the master valve (or pump start relay) to one of the timer terminals marked COMMON

Additional instructions for connecting a pump start relay

To avoid possible pump damage, connect a short jumper wire from any unused zone terminal(s) to the previous terminal, continuing back to the nearest zone terminal in use (as shown below). For example, if a 4 zone model timer is in use with only two zones connected, route the terminals for zones 3 and 4 to the nearest active terminal (zone 2 in the example below).Rain Bird SST600in 6-Station Indoor Simple-To-Set Irrigation Timer - 11

WARNING: Make sure that the total draw of the master valve (and/or pump start relay) plus the draw of the valve does not exceed 650mA at 24VAC, 60hz. Note that the timer does NOT provide main power for a pump.

Seasonal Adjust

  • Adjust for seasonal weather variationRain Bird SST600in 6-Station Indoor Simple-To-Set Irrigation Timer - 21
  • Turn the dial to SEASONAL ADJUST
  • Press the UP/DOWN arrow keys to adjust the percentage.
  • For example, a +50% adjustment means 10 min. becomes 15 min.
  • NOTE: Adjustment applies to ALL watering run times (durations) for all zones.

Troubleshooting

Watering Issues

ProblemPossible CausePossible Solution
Automatic and manual cycles do not begin watering.Water source not supplying water.Verify the main water and all supply lines are open and operating properly.
Wires not properly connected.Verify field wires are connected properly including the timer, master valve (or pump start relay) and any spliced connections.
Wires damaged or corroded.Check field wiring for damage and replace if necessary. Check all connections and replace with watertight connectors as needed.
Dial not set to AUTO RUN position.Turn the dial to set date and set time and use UP/Down arrows to set correct date and time.
Date and/or Time is not set correctly.Enter the current Date and Time on the controller.
An installed Rain Sensor may be activated.Operation will resume when sensor dries out. To test operation, disconnect the Sensor and connect a jumper wire between the Rain Sensor terminals.
If no Rain Sensor is installed, the jumper wire may be damaged or missing.Connect the two yellow Rain Sensor terminals with a short length of 14 to 18 gauge jumper wire.
An electrical surge may have damaged the timer’s electronics.Disconnect power to the timer for 3 minutes, press the reset button, then turn back on. If there is no damage, the timer will accept programming and resume normal operation.
Watering cycles do not shut off.Debris trapped in valve.Flush the valve by temporarily opening the bleed-screw and re-tighten.

Electrical Issues

ProblemPossible CausePossible Solution
LCD Display is blank.Timer is not receiving power.Verify the power cord is connected and securely plugged in (indoor).
Verify the transformer is wired correctly and the circuit breaker is on (outdoor).
No red LED light on transformer (indoor only).Blown transformer.Replace transformer.
LCD Display is “frozen” and timer will not accept programming.An electrical surge may have damaged the timer’s electronics.Disconnect power to the timer for 3 minutes, press the reset button, then turn back on. If there is no damage, the timer will accept programming and resume normal operation.
Valve short error message on LCD display.Wires damaged or corroded.Check the indicated zone wiring for damage and replace if necessary. Check all connections and replace with watertight connectors as needed.
